Summary: A Hadoop cluster is a collection of interconnected nodes that work together to store and process large datasets using the Hadoop framework. Introduction A Hadoop cluster is a group of interconnected computers, or nodes, that work together to store and process large datasets using the Hadoop framework.

Summary: This article compares Spark vs Hadoop, highlighting Spark’s fast, in-memory processing and Hadoop’s disk-based, batch processing model. Introduction Apache Spark and Hadoop are potent frameworks for big data processing and distributed computing. What is Apache Hadoop? What is Apache Spark?
